Block

#20,942,066
Block Number
20,942,066 @ 02/19/2025, 07:18:50
Status
Finalized
ID
0x013f8cf24924b455fcde3318e8c6f4bdf593b67d54f025f8d1321e2ddc910c41
Transactions
Gas Used
6708550/39999962 (16.77% Used)
Total Score
2,044,573,208 (+99)
Rewards
24.74 VTHO